
The two lecturers at the Marine Science Center at the University of Basra, Prof. Dr. Ghassan Adnan Kamel and Assistant Professor Dr. Dhafar Zahir Habib, participated in the discussion committee of the thesis of the doctoral student Mahasin Ghaffar Hashim in the Department of Fisheries and Marine Resources, College of Agriculture, University of Basra, which dealt with the use of some environmental and biological indicators to assess the quality of water in the Shatt al-Arab, north of Basra city, southern Iraq.
The thesis aimed to study the changes in environmental factors and their impact on the quality of the Shatt al-Arab water and the composition of the fish population, and to determine the quality category of the Shatt al-Arab water and the relationship between biological and environmental indicators.
The study included three stations, namely Al-Qurna, Al-Deir and Al-Hartha, in which 47 fish species were recorded, and the values of the water quality index and the biological integration index were shown for each station.
